**Requirements:**
* Completed undergraduate degree in Nursing;
* Active and regular COREN registration;
* Personal vehicle, insured, with driver's license category B;
* Experience in nursing assistance routines in ICU, Surgical Center; knowledge of OPME (Orthopedic, Prosthetic, and Medical Equipment), auditing, SAE (Healthcare Assistance System), and health-related standards and legislation.
**Responsibilities:**
* Conduct retrospective manual and electronic audits of supplies, medications, OPME, and procedures in medical records of discharged patients made available by healthcare service providers, based on contractual agreements, audit manuals, and internal protocols;
* Perform concurrent audits for inpatients in ICU, Surgical Center, or other situations as requested, recording necessary information;
* Reach consensus with healthcare service providers regarding discrepancies identified in invoices, delivering continuing education;
* Report non-conformities, changes in provider routines—including modifications to standardization of supplies and medications—directly to the Nursing Analyst or Audit Supervision;
* Record process-related information for statistical analysis to support evaluations and decision-making;
* Assess and report opportunities for process improvement aimed at optimizing activities and reducing healthcare costs;
* Critically evaluate the quality of provided care and report technical discrepancies and identified distortions to the Nursing Analyst;
* Record information related to beneficiaries of exchange programs in the designated Exchange Report form;
* Forward provider inquiries to the Nursing Analyst;
* Organize the billing workflow for auditing, supporting Medical Auditing;
* Monitor and ensure compliance with scheduled audit deadlines and account closure timelines (SLA and accounting periods);
* Review re-submission/complement protocols;
* Prepare technical opinions on inpatients, supplies, equipment, medications, related legislation, and other matters;
* Participate in developing new projects (as per technical expertise) when requested;
* Support execution of other department/unit activities at the supervisor’s discretion;
* Attend training sessions and courses to enhance auditing skills;
* Provide technical guidance to team members.
